Changelog

v0.17.0

  • PHX-455

    • [Fixed] Synchronous psycopg database calls inside async FastAPI endpoints are now offloaded via asyncio.to_thread() to prevent event loop blocking.

    • [Fixed] DLM storage/location table access is now probed once at startup via a lightweight SELECT 1 FROM storage LIMIT 1 query. When the DPD database user lacks permission on the DLM storage and location tables the application immediately falls back to data_item-only queries for the lifetime of the process, removing all per-request try/catch/retry logic.

    • [Performance] PostgreSQL full reindex now uses a single bulk executemany() upsert: all files are buffered during indexing and written in batches via one psycopg.connect() instead of one connection per file. Reduces full reindex time from ~20–30 minutes to < 30 seconds for a 3,000-product PV.

    • [Performance] _promote_placeholder_if_exists() is now skipped during a full reindex: the metadata table is re-created empty before each reindex run so placeholder promotion is always a no-op at that point.

    • [Added] Per-volume PostgreSQL table names: table names are now derived automatically from a UUID identity file on the PV root.

    • [Added] dpd_indexing_state coordination table: on startup each API pod claims an indexing lease for its volume prefix; only the leader scans the PV, non-leaders skip and serve from shared tables.

    • [Changed] DROP TABLE on startup replaced with CREATE TABLE IF NOT EXISTS; metadata is preserved across restarts and kept current via upserts.

    • [Changed] /status response restructured: indexing fields consolidated under a single indexing object (in_progress, progress, coordination_state); redundant fields removed from pv_interface_status, metadata_store_status, and search_store_status.

    • [Changed] DLM queries now expose only the specific storage and location columns needed by consumers.

    • [Fixed] DLM ORDER BY now uses table-qualified references for native data_item columns (e.g. uid_creation, item_state) and storage/location columns instead of routing all sort fields through the metadata JSONB.

    • [Fixed] Search-panel key:value pair filters (e.g. execution_block:eb-xxx) are now applied to DLM rows via data_item.metadata JSONB.

    • [Fixed] DLM rows are excluded when a date_created filter is active, as DLM has no date_created column.

    • [Added] User guide section and developer guide configuration reference for the DLM integration.

    • [Changed] Changed the unique ID of data products from the execution_block_id to a UUID. This allows sub products of an execution_block to be loaded as a separate data product on the DPD.

    • [Fixed] Updated the in memory search store that failed to load new data on a re-index of the PV.

    • [Changed] Changed the /dataproductmetadata endpoint to expect a data products UUID instead of a execution_block_id, which is not unique in the case where there are sub products inside a data product.

    • [Changed] Updated the /download endpoint to accept either the execution_block_id or a UUID. The UUID is used to differentiate between sub products inside a data product when downloading from the dashboard. If there are more than one match for data products of an execution_block_id, they will all be downloaded when calling the endpoint with an execution_block_id.

    • [Changed] Updated the response of the /ingestnewdataproduct and /ingestnewmetadata endpoint to reply with an http response and uuid of the product submitted.

  • NAL-1146

    • BREAKING [Added] Added the concept of access_group to the metadata. This limits the access to data products if the user, authenticated with MS Entra, has not been assigned to the access_group of the data product. When using the API with the Data Product Dashboard, the user can authenticate with MS Entra. When loading the data products (using the filterdataproducts endpoint) the users access token will be used to retrieve the users assigned user groups, and that will be used as access list to determine which data products the user have access to. Data products that does not have an access_group assigned, will be open access to all users. Note: When using the API for scripted access to data products all data products will be accessible as it is assume the the user inside the VPN have access to all the data.
